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pollokshaws East to St Margarets (London) start from as little as £51.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pollokshaws East to St Margarets (London) start from £128.70 one way, or £183.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pollokshaws East to St Margarets (London) are available for £203.10 one way, or £406.20 return

Station Facilities at Pollokshaws East

While Pollokshaws East may not have a traditional ticket office, ticket purchases and collections are a breeze thanks to the station's user-friendly ticket machines. These machines are accessible and cater to online ticket collections, ensuring that you never miss an opportunity for a spontaneous adventure. While the absence of ticket barriers can raise eyebrows, it's all part of an effort to streamline your experience without undue hassle. Conveniently, the induction loop is available for enhanced auditory assistance, and there are helpful customer service touchpoints even in the absence of on-site staff.

However, the station's charm doesn't extend to amenities like toilets or refreshment facilities, so it's best to plan your pit stops elsewhere. Families traveling with little ones might find the lack of baby-changing and lounge facilities a hurdle, but the station offers a cozy seating area where you can wait for your train.

Accessibility and Transport Links

Accessibility matters are worth noting—Pollokshaws East is categorized as a Category C station, which unfortunately means there are no step-free access points. Staircases to the island platform could be challenging for those with mobility issues, making alternative arrangements advisable.

For worry-free navigation beyond the station, Pollokshaws East maintains impressive links with other transport options. Bus services frequently connect from nearby Kilmarnock Road, providing seamless connections across the city. More details on available routes can be found at Traveline Scotland. Taxis are easily accessible with further information available through Train Taxi.

Facilities and Services

The station offers a range of facilities designed to make your journey smooth and comfortable. The ticket office operates from early morning to evening on weekdays, ensuring you have ample opportunity to plan and purchase travel as needed. Alternatively, ticket machines are readily available for those on-the-go moments. Importantly, accessible ticket machines provide flexibility for travelers with disabilities, making ticket purchases hassle-free.

While enjoying a warming beverage from the onsite coffee shop, passengers can take advantage of the waiting rooms on Platforms 1 and 2. These heated spaces offer a cozy retreat from the hustle and bustle of travel. Although there's no ATM or extensive shopping options, the station's focus on essentials complements its friendly community vibe.

For those with specific mobility needs, it's helpful to note that St Margarets offers step-free access in certain areas, particularly towards Twickenham and Strawberry Hill. However, travelers should consult the station's detailed access note for a comprehensive understanding of available facilities and foreseeable restrictions.
